给linux添加vim包,Ubuntu16.04安装vim出错:E: 软件包vim没有可供安装的候选者
今天安裝vim時遇到的問題。
1.用root賬戶登錄Ubuntu,命令行中輸入vim,如果未安裝會得到下面的提示:
程序“vim”已包含在下列軟件包中:
* vim
* vim-gnome
* vim-tiny
* vim-gtk
* vim-nox
請嘗試:apt-get install
按照提示輸入apt-get install vim安裝。
2.在輸入sudo apt-get installl vim時出現如下錯誤:
正在讀取軟件包列表… 完成
正在分析軟件包的依賴關系樹
正在讀取狀態信息… 完成
現在沒有可用的軟件包 vim,但是它被其它的軟件包引用了。
這可能意味著這個缺失的軟件包可能已被廢棄,
或者只能在其他發布源中找到
E: 軟件包 vim 沒有可供安裝的候選者
3.解決方法
一,更新軟件源
軟件源使用國內比較知名的軟件源例如163,清華,中科大等的軟件源這些軟件源的訪問速度在國內也是比較快的,下面是清華的軟件源:
輸入命令:sudo vim /etc/apt/sources.list
將source內容更改為:
#tsing hua mirror site
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ial main multiverse restricted universe
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-backports main multiverse restricted universe
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-proposed main multiverse restricted universe
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-security main multiverse restricted universe
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-updates main multiverse restricted universe
de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ial main multiverse restricted universe
de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-backports main multiverse restricted universe
de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-proposed main multiverse restricted universe
de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-security main multiverse restricted universe
deb-src http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 xenial-updates main multiverse restricted universe
不同發行版的Linux 操作系統的不同版本也是不一樣的,大家根據自己的發行版對應的版本靈活使用。
清華TUNA鏡像源地址:https://mirrors.tuna.tsinghua.edu.cn/help/ubuntu/
二,系統升級
sudo apt-get update
sudo apt-get upgrade
三,安裝vim
sudo apt-get install vim
之后有提示顯示成功安裝
4.安裝完成后,輸入vim會進入vim的標準模式,這時按鍵盤的insert進入插入模式,在里面寫點什么吧。
5.按Esc推出插入模式,進入標準模式,在這個模式下有幾個基本命令要掌握。
:wq 保存推出
i 進入插入模式
x 刪除當前光標的字符
dd 刪除當前行,并且保存當前行到剪切板
p粘貼
:help 查看命令的幫助
上下左右移動光標
6.輸入:wq 保存文件并退出編輯。
7.下次輸入vim filename就可以編輯或者查看這個文件了。
總結
以上是生活随笔為你收集整理的给linux添加vim包,Ubuntu16.04安装vim出错:E: 软件包vim没有可供安装的候选者的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: kafka监控api,手撕面试官
- 下一篇: CAD删除数据库对象